scripts/checksyscalls.sh: only whine perf_counter_open when supported

If the port does not support HAVE_PERF_COUNTERS, then they can't support
the perf_counter_open syscall either.  Rather than forcing everyone to add
an ignore (or suffer the warning until they get around to implementing
support), only whine about the syscall when applicable.
